Lookaheads and lookbehinds are zero-width assertions — they check for a pattern but don’t include the matched characters in the result. This lets you match text based on what comes before or after it, without capturing that context.
The four assertion types
| Syntax | Name | Matches when |
|---|---|---|
(?=X) | Positive lookahead | X follows the current position |
(?!X) | Negative lookahead | X does NOT follow |
(?<=X) | Positive lookbehind | X precedes the current position |
(?<!X) | Negative lookbehind | X does NOT precede |
Positive lookahead (?=...)
Match text only if followed by a specific pattern:
\d+(?=\s*dollars?)
This matches the number before “dollar” or “dollars”, but the word isn’t included in the match:
import re
text = "I have 100 dollars and 50 euros"
matches = re.findall(r'\d+(?=\s*dollars?)', text)
print(matches) # ['100'] (not '50' — it's not followed by "dollar")
Another example — match a word before a colon:
text = "name: Alice\nage: 30\ncity: London"
keys = re.findall(r'\w+(?=:)', text)
print(keys) # ['name', 'age', 'city']

Password validation — must contain at least one digit:
^(?=.*\d).{8,}$
def has_digit(password):
return bool(re.match(r'^(?=.*\d).{8,}$', password))
has_digit("password") # False (no digit)
has_digit("passw0rd") # True
Positive lookbehind (?<=...)
Match text only if preceded by a specific pattern:
(?<=\$)\d+(?:\.\d{2})?
Matches the number after a dollar sign, without including the $:
text = "Items cost $42.99 and $10.00 total"
prices = re.findall(r'(?<=\$)\d+(?:\.\d{2})?', text)
print(prices) # ['42.99', '10.00']
Extract values after a key:
text = "user=alice&role=admin&id=42"
role = re.search(r'(?<=role=)\w+', text)
print(role.group()) # 'admin'

Combining multiple lookaheads
Lookaheads can be chained at the same position. This is how complex password validation works:
# Password must be:
# - 8+ characters
# - At least one lowercase letter
# - At least one uppercase letter
# - At least one digit
# - At least one symbol
pattern = r'^(?=.*[a-z])(?=.*[A-Z])(?=.*\d)(?=.*[!@#$%^&*]).{8,}$'
def validate_password(pwd):
return bool(re.match(pattern, pwd))
validate_password("Password1!") # True
validate_password("password1!") # False (no uppercase)
validate_password("PASSWORD1!") # False (no lowercase)
